Jabal Khayrī
Jabal Khayrī is a mountain in Amedi, Dohuk Governorate and has an elevation of 1,645 metres. Jabal Khayrī is situated nearby to the locality Mirsīdah, as well as near Miseleka.| Tap on a place to explore it |
